Find a course
Showing 243 results
Computing
Take your study of computing further with advanced modules and an industrial placement in this integrated Master's degree.
Computing (Artificial Intelligence and Machine Learning)
Deepen your knowledge and understanding of artificial intelligence and machine learning to prepare for a career in the computing industry.
Computing (Artificial Intelligence and Machine Learning)
Focus your study of computing on artificial intelligence in this integrated Master’s degree.
Computing (International Programme of Study)
Enrich your computing degree with the chance to study abroad in this integrated Master’s course.
Computing (Management and Finance)
Specialise in the management of software development and the application of software technology.
Computing (Management and Finance)
Specialise in computational management and finance in this integrated Master’s degree.
Computing (Security and Reliability)
Enhance your knowledge of IT security and reliability to prepare for a career in the computing industry.
Computing (Security and Reliability)
Learn how modern computer and communications systems can be adapted to build the next generation of secure computing applications.
Computing (Software Engineering)
Specialise in the application of engineering to the design, development, and maintenance of software.
Computing (Software Engineering)
Focus on how software is engineered to form complex computing systems in this integrated Master’s degree.



.jpg)
.jpg)
.jpg)

.jpg)

.jpg)

.jpg)